When two twin beds are put together, they typically measure 76 inches wide by 75 inches long, which is the same size as a standard king-size bed. Each twin bed measures 38 inches wide by 75 inches long. This configuration is often used to create a larger sleeping surface while maintaining the flexibility of individual beds.

Most bunk beds are made so they can be separated into twin beds. You can find these at any furniture retail store. You just life the top bunk off the bottom one and it makes a normal bed.

Yes, two twin beds can be pushed together to create a larger sleeping space, but there may be a gap in the middle where the beds meet.

To prevent two twin beds from moving apart, you can use a bed bridge or a mattress connector to secure them together. These devices help keep the beds aligned and prevent them from separating.
